Output 20fdeeb86f39805d6a781ca1b0e4a00c4e5e7a26018515af9aa8aabdb4a604cf:7

value
8478145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3377220773584e44f88156fafb21ef731563d46c OP_EQUAL
address
36P96pyQvszzJv87KvVEmmp2uKLkmoKcqT
transaction
20fdeeb86f39805d6a781ca1b0e4a00c4e5e7a26018515af9aa8aabdb4a604cf
spent
true